What is an infrastructure systems engineer?

Infrastructure Systems Engineers are IT professionals responsible for designing, implementing, managing, and maintaining an organization's IT infrastructure. This includes servers, networks, cloud services, storage, and other foundational systems that support applications and business operations. They ensure systems are reliable, secure, and scalable, often troubleshooting issues, optimizing performance, and planning for future technology needs. Their work is crucial for the smooth operation and security of a company's technology environ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an infrastructure systems engineer?

To thrive as an Infrastructure Systems Engineer, you need expertise in systems administration, networking, virtualization, and a solid understanding of operating systems, usually supported by a relevant degree or certifications like CompTIA, Cisco, or Microsoft. Familiarity with tools such as VMware, Hyper-V, Linux/Windows servers, cloud platforms (AWS, Azure), and monitoring systems is typically required.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and the ability to work collaboratively are crucial so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ure reliable infrastructure performance, efficient troubleshooting, and seamless integration of new technologies to support business operations.

What are some common challenges infrastructure systems engineers face when managing complex IT environments?

Infrastructure Systems Engineers often encounter challenges such as balancing the need for system reliability with ongoing updates and maintenance tasks. They must troubleshoot and resolve issues quickly to minimize downtime, while also planning and implementing upgrades for scalability and security. Coordinating with cross-functional teams, such as network administrators and application developers, is essential to ensure system compatibility and performance. Adapting to rapidly changing technologies and managing multiple projects simultaneously are also typical aspects of the role.

What is the difference between Infrastructure Systems Engineer vs Network Engineer?

AspectInfrastructure Systems EngineerNetwork Engineer
CertificationsComp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NA, Microsoft certificationsComp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NA, Juniper JNCIA
Work EnvironmentData centers, enterprise IT environments, cloud infrastructureNetwork operations centers, enterprise networks, service providers
ResponsibilitiesDesign, implement, and maintain IT infrastructure, servers, and cloud systemsConfigure, troubleshoot, and optimize network hardware and connectivity

While both roles involve network and infrastructure knowledge, Infrastructure Systems Engineers focus on overall IT infrastructure, including servers and cloud systems, whereas Network Engineers specialize in network hardware and connectivity.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or job focus.

Job description

Job Title: Infrastructure Systems Engineer
Experience Level: 5+ Years
Location: Durham, NC (5 days onsite)
Department: Information Technology / Infrastructure Services

Note: This is a C2H role, please submit visa independent candidates
Position Summary
We are seeking a highly skilled and experienced Infrastructure Systems Engineer to lead the implementation, administration and support of our enterprise and cloud infrastructure services from our Durham location. This role requires deep expertise in Dell server platforms, NetApp storage systems, VMware virtualization technologies, and cloud service providers services (AWS and Azure). The ideal candidate will be a strategic thinker with strong technical acumen and a proactive approach to ensuring the reliability, scalability, and performance of Client's's global infrastructure. You will play a crucial role in enabling the technology that powers our cutting-edge semiconductor manufacturing.
Key Responsibilities
  • Implement, deploy, and maintain enterprise-grade infrastructure solutions utilizing Dell servers, NetApp storage, VMware virtualization, and cloud platforms (AWS and Azure).
  • Design, implement, and manage cloud infrastructure services (AWS/Azure), including compute, storage, networking, and security configurations.
  • Lead complex infrastructure projects, including cloud migrations, hybrid integrations, upgrades, and capacity planning.
  • Manage and optimize NetApp storage systems, ensuring high availability, performance, and data integrity.
  • Administer and enhance VMware environments, including ESXi hosts, vCenter, virtual networking, and lifecycle management.
  • Collaborate with network, security, and application teams to ensure seamless integration and optimal performance of all infrastructure components.
  • Develop and maintain infrastructure automation scripts and tools using PowerShell, Python, Bash, and cloud-native automation tools.
  • Proactively monitor system health, performance, and security across on-premises and cloud environments.
  • Provide expert Tier 3 support and technical mentorship to junior engineers and technicians within the global team.
  • Develop and maintain detailed documentation of infrastructure architecture, configurations, and operational procedures.
  • Participate in disaster recovery planning, testing, and execution to ensure business continuity.

Required Qualifications
  • 5+ years of experience in infrastructure engineering and systems administration.
  • Expert-level knowledge of Dell server hardware and management tools (e.g., iDRAC, OpenManage).
  • Extensive experience with NetApp storage systems, including administration, configuration, and protocols (NFS, CIFS, iSCSI).
  • Advanced proficiency in VMware vSphere, ESXi, vCenter, and related virtualization technologies.
  • Advanced proficiency in AWS and Azure cloud infrastructure, including services for compute, storage, networking, and security.
  • Strong scripting skills (PowerShell, Python, Bash) for infrastructure automation and monitoring.
  • Solid understanding of networking fundamentals, SAN environments, and Windows/Linux server administration.
  • Solid understanding of cloud networking fundamentals, compute, storage, and identity management.
  • Proven ability to lead complex infrastructure projects and provide mentorship to junior staff.
  • Excellent troubleshooting, analytical, and problem-solving skills.
  • Strong communication and documentation skills.

Preferred Certifications
  • VMware Certified Professional (VCP)
  • NetApp Certified Data Administrator (NCDA)
  • AWS Certified Solutions Architect or Azure Administrator Associate (or equivalent)
